diff options
Diffstat (limited to 'include/uapi')
-rw-r--r-- | include/uapi/linux/nvgpu.h | 16 |
1 files changed, 15 insertions, 1 deletions
diff --git a/include/uapi/linux/nvgpu.h b/include/uapi/linux/nvgpu.h index 9197011b..786f8268 100644 --- a/include/uapi/linux/nvgpu.h +++ b/include/uapi/linux/nvgpu.h | |||
@@ -166,6 +166,8 @@ struct nvgpu_gpu_zbc_query_table_args { | |||
166 | #define NVGPU_GPU_FLAGS_CAN_RAILGATE (1ULL << 29) | 166 | #define NVGPU_GPU_FLAGS_CAN_RAILGATE (1ULL << 29) |
167 | /* Usermode submit is available */ | 167 | /* Usermode submit is available */ |
168 | #define NVGPU_GPU_FLAGS_SUPPORT_USERMODE_SUBMIT (1ULL << 30) | 168 | #define NVGPU_GPU_FLAGS_SUPPORT_USERMODE_SUBMIT (1ULL << 30) |
169 | /* Set MMU debug mode is available */ | ||
170 | #define NVGPU_GPU_FLAGS_SUPPORT_SET_CTX_MMU_DEBUG_MODE (1ULL << 32) | ||
169 | /* SM LRF ECC is enabled */ | 171 | /* SM LRF ECC is enabled */ |
170 | #define NVGPU_GPU_FLAGS_ECC_ENABLED_SM_LRF (1ULL << 60) | 172 | #define NVGPU_GPU_FLAGS_ECC_ENABLED_SM_LRF (1ULL << 60) |
171 | /* SM SHM ECC is enabled */ | 173 | /* SM SHM ECC is enabled */ |
@@ -1414,8 +1416,20 @@ struct nvgpu_dbg_gpu_set_sm_exception_type_mask_args { | |||
1414 | _IOW(NVGPU_DBG_GPU_IOCTL_MAGIC, 23, \ | 1416 | _IOW(NVGPU_DBG_GPU_IOCTL_MAGIC, 23, \ |
1415 | struct nvgpu_dbg_gpu_set_sm_exception_type_mask_args) | 1417 | struct nvgpu_dbg_gpu_set_sm_exception_type_mask_args) |
1416 | 1418 | ||
1419 | /* MMU Debug Mode */ | ||
1420 | #define NVGPU_DBG_GPU_CTX_MMU_DEBUG_MODE_DISABLED 0 | ||
1421 | #define NVGPU_DBG_GPU_CTX_MMU_DEBUG_MODE_ENABLED 1 | ||
1422 | |||
1423 | struct nvgpu_dbg_gpu_set_ctx_mmu_debug_mode_args { | ||
1424 | __u32 mode; | ||
1425 | __u32 reserved; | ||
1426 | }; | ||
1427 | #define NVGPU_DBG_GPU_IOCTL_SET_CTX_MMU_DEBUG_MODE \ | ||
1428 | _IOW(NVGPU_DBG_GPU_IOCTL_MAGIC, 26, \ | ||
1429 | struct nvgpu_dbg_gpu_set_ctx_mmu_debug_mode_args) | ||
1430 | |||
1417 | #define NVGPU_DBG_GPU_IOCTL_LAST \ | 1431 | #define NVGPU_DBG_GPU_IOCTL_LAST \ |
1418 | _IOC_NR(NVGPU_DBG_GPU_IOCTL_SET_SM_EXCEPTION_TYPE_MASK) | 1432 | _IOC_NR(NVGPU_DBG_GPU_IOCTL_SET_CTX_MMU_DEBUG_MODE) |
1419 | 1433 | ||
1420 | #define NVGPU_DBG_GPU_IOCTL_MAX_ARG_SIZE \ | 1434 | #define NVGPU_DBG_GPU_IOCTL_MAX_ARG_SIZE \ |
1421 | sizeof(struct nvgpu_dbg_gpu_access_fb_memory_args) | 1435 | sizeof(struct nvgpu_dbg_gpu_access_fb_memory_args) |